The new, cheaper alternative that has been floated by The City to host a prestigious yacht race equates to $95 million less investment in waterfront infrastructure, but would not require public land to be turned over to private investors.Despite the loss of the $95 million, city officials say the newer alternative focuses investment dollars on piers The City wants to develop and would advance a much-desired cruise terminal.
